1. MSI GS66 Stealth (Editors’ Choice)

best laptops for cuda development

Check Price on Amazon

Our Editors’ Choice for the best laptop for CUDA development is the MSI GS66 Stealth. It’s hugely powerful under the hood, and outwardly classy. It has a CUDA compute capability of 8.6.

The combination of Nvidia RTX 3080 and Intel Core i7-10870H make great bedfellows, making the MSI GS66 an impressive laptop. The 16GB of RAM on this outstanding gaming rig means that multitasking and playing demanding blockbusters, even at maxed-out settings barely slow things down.

On another important front, the GS66 Stealth’s Full HD display boasts an impressive 300Hz refresh rate and 3ms response rate. There are configurations with the same response time, however, with a 300Hz refresh rate.

That said, we feel less thrilled by the MSI GS66’s display brightness, which could be better.

In terms of physical size and weight, the GS66 Stealth (14.2 inches and 4.5 pounds) is a lightweight and easy travel companion. For comparison’s sake, the Gigabyte Aorus 5 (14.2 inches and 4.85 pounds), and Dell G5 15 SE (14.4 inches and 5.51 pounds) are heavier.

A respectable set of ports are located on either side of the laptop’s chassis. The right side features two USB 3.2 Gen 2 Type-A ports, a USB 3.2 Gen Type-C port, an input for Gigabit Ethernet and a headset jack. The left side holds another USB 3.2 Gen 2 Type-A port, a Thunderbolt 3 port, an HDMI 2.0 port and the power port.

Let’s not forget the MSI GS66 Stealth’s sublime audio system. The speakers on either side of the laptop offer audio that is loud, clean and rich.

A notable performance chop worth mentioning is the Reflex which reduces latency with the help of G-Sync tech.

Depending on the game you’re playing, the GS66 Stealth can offer framerates as high as 93 fps at 1080p.

We are impressed by MSI’s CoolerBoost technology which takes care of cooling GS66 Stealth’s internals. This technology does not remove heat completely, though.

The GS66 Stealth delivers strong battery life. You should get at least 6 hours on a charge. For superior battery power, consider the Asus ROG Zephyrus G14 or Asus ROG Strix Scar III.

If you need a thin and light laptop with solid internals for CUDA programming, this is it.

2. Asus ROG Zephyrus G14 

best laptops for cuda development

Check Price on Amazon

The Asus ROG Zephyrus G14 is a capable laptop that packs tons of performance at a relatively affordable price. It has a CUDA compute capability of 7.5.

Wielding an Nvidia GeForce RTX 2060 Max-Q GPU, 16GB of RAM, 1TB of storage and AMD’s Ryzen 9 4900HS processor, it stacks up nicely to the competition. The base model ships with Ryzen 9-4900HS CPU, Nvidia GTX 1650 GPU, 8GG of RAM and 512GB SSD.

You can upgrade to the ROG Zephyrus G15 which sports GeForce RTX 3080 GPU and AMD Ryzen 9 5900HS CPU.

At 3.53 pounds, with a 12.76 x 8.74 x 0.70-inch chassis, the Asus ROG Zephyrus G14 is arguably one of the lightest and smallest gaming laptops you can buy now.

You’ll be hard-pressed to use all the ports found along the Zephyrus G14’s frame. It has a good selection of ports for gaming and streaming. On the left there’s one USB-C port, and HDMI 2.0b port, a DisplayPort, plus an audio/mic port. While the right side has two USB 3.0 ports, a USB Type-C port and a Kensington lock slot.

With regard to gaming performance, the Asus ROG Zephyrus G14 can blaze through AAA games at the highest settings just like Asus ROG Strix Scar III, MSI GL75, and Dell G7 15.

What else should we include? Thermal management is spot on. Unlike the Lenovo Legion Y545 and Dell G5 15 SE, the Zephyrus G14 does not run hot while gaming. You’ll find lots of ventilation grilles on the laptop.

However, there are some trade-offs. You won’t find a webcam on the Zephyrus G14. We recommend getting an external webcam if you’d like to stream via Twitch.

You are ultimately getting a gaming laptop from Asus that can last long enough to get some real work done. Roughly speaking, you’re looking at about 12 hours of battery life as configured from Asus.

4. Alienware X15 R2

best laptops for cuda development

Check Price on Amazon

The Alienware X15 R2 stands out as a top-tier gaming laptop, renowned for its impressive specifications that elevate the gaming experience. With its 15.6-inch FHD display boasting a remarkable 360Hz refresh rate, gaming becomes an incredibly smooth and immersive affair. Fueling this powerhouse is the 12th Generation Intel Core i7-12700H processor, armed with 14 cores and a clock speed of up to 4.70 GHz, delivering robust computing capabilities for both gaming and multitasking.

Adding to its allure, the laptop flaunts a striking design in an elegant white hue, complemented by captivating RGB lighting at the back. Despite its weight of five pounds, the thin chassis imparts a surprisingly lightweight feel, a testament to its exceptional balance.

In terms of performance, the Alienware X15 R2 truly shines. It not only excels in CPU and GPU benchmarks but also proves its mettle in stress tests involving demanding PC games. Surpassing many counterparts with similar specifications and sizes, it sets a high standard in the gaming laptop arena.

However, a few considerations temper the overall praise. The webcam, despite its technical 1080p capability, falls short in practical use, displaying subpar frame rates and visuals during conference calls. The battery life, limited to around three hours at most, demands frequent charging, posing a potential inconvenience. Additionally, the slim chassis raises concerns about overheating, though the well-designed software empowers users to manage this issue by adjusting fan settings. Despite these drawbacks, the Alienware X15 R2 remains a formidable gaming laptop, offering a stellar gaming experience with a few caveats to keep in mind.

6. MSI GL75 Gaming Laptop 

best laptops for cuda development

 Check Price on Amazon

Another good laptop for CUDA development is the MSI GL75. Its CUDA compute capability is 7.5.

Its display is pretty good with excellent brightness and contrast ratio. Viewing angles are good, too.

The MSI GL75 pairs an eighth-generation Intel Core i7-9750H processor with 512GB of storage, 16GB of RAM, and Nvidia RTX 2060 graphics. Need more storage? Then opt for the configuration with Intel Core i7-9750H processor, 16GB of RAM, NVidia GTX 1660 Ti graphics and 256GB SSD + 1TB HDD.

On the other hand, if you’ve got deep pockets, you can also upgrade to one with NVIDIA GeForce GTX 1660 Ti graphics, paired with 2TB PCIe SSD and 1TB HDD These configurations (except the RTX 2060 version) have the same 144Hz Full HD display.

It ranks very high for its gaming performance.

Port selection is otherwise top-notch. On the MSI GL75’s left edge, you’ll find an HDMI port, a Mini DisplayPort, a USB Type-A 3.1 (Gen 1) port, a USB Type-C 3.1 (Gen. 2) port, and two audio jacks – one for a mic, and another for headphones. The right edge hosts a power plug, two USB Type-A 3.1 (Gen 1) ports and an SD card reader.

It’s hard to miss the vents that line the four sides. So you need not worry about cooling. The MSI GL75 has a good cooling setup.

Then, there are the bottom-firing speakers on MSI GL75 which pump out clear sound.

Battery life is just average, so don’t expect its runtimes to stretch into the double figures without taking a booster pack along for the ride.

The MSI GL75’s largest downfall, however, is likely going to come down to the fans. They serve a good purpose, but they can get loud during gaming.

There’s no getting around the fact that the MSI GL75 is an excellent laptop for CUDA development.
